Iran claims more gains in a drive against Iraq

January 13, 1981

Iran claimed further victories in its week-old counteroffensive against Iraq and said it had routed two Iraqi battalions in recent fighting on the western front, the official Pars News Agency reported. Tehran Radio quoted Prime Minister Muhammad Ali Rajai as saying that "we have achieved glorious victories. We have got back major parts of our lands . . . ."

Meanwhile, Iraq is continuing to discount Iranian clai ms of major victories in the Persian Gulf war.
